**Step 6 — Partition cutover (Marrowgate DB)**

Partition `events` by calendar month. Run the migration during the low-traffic window. Verify `events_2025_01` through current month exist before flipping the router flag. Old monolithic table stays read-only for two weeks, then drops. Check row counts match pre-cutover snapshot; any drift over 0.01% aborts the release. Deploy artifact must be signed before the scheduler will accept it. Sign the migration bundle with the key below.

signing key of bagap-yawep = bky13_TbfT6ZMUoGJo2

CI note: encoding sniffer flakes on Quillbasin uploads

Heads up — the charset detector in the Quillbasin ingest job sometimes misreads UTF-16 text files as Latin-1 when the BOM is stripped by the proxy. Not exploitable as far as we can tell, but worth a second look. The failing job's trace token is below.

session token of yahof-bajeg = htk9_0d43d44ed

Handover — Lease Renegotiation. Teo, picking up where I left off: the Dravenmoor landlord agreed in principle to a five-year term with a rent holiday through spring. Still haggling over fit-out costs. Keep Ilsa at Bramhold Estates warm. Branch managers should hold off any relocation chatter. Context on our broader plans is below.

confidential, bahap-bajog: Zorethix Works is in early talks to buy Kelethox Foods for about $30.7 million. The Ralvan launch date is September 19, and nothing goes to the press before then.

# Break-Glass: ThumbForge Queue

If the ThumbForge thumbnail workers stall and the on-call owner for the Marrowvale cluster is unreachable, reviewers may use break-glass access to drain the queue. This bypasses normal approval, so log the incident immediately afterward. The break-glass console accepts a single recovery passphrase, recorded on the line below for authorized use.

vault phrase of bagaf-kajeg = jorath-feniel-briir-siliel-ralix